  8. Global network -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Global_networks

    A global network is any communication network that spans the entire Earth. The term, as used in this article, refers in a more restricted way to bidirectional communication networks based on technology. Early networks such as international mail and unidirectional communication networks, such as radio and television, are described elsewhere.

  9. Internetworking -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Internetworking

    Internetworking is the practice of interconnecting multiple computer networks, [1]: 169 such that any pair of hosts in the connected networks can exchange messages irrespective of their hardware-level networking technology. The resulting system of interconnected networks is called an internetwork, or simply an internet.
